 void NotifyMainThread(SQLConnection* connection_with_new_result)
 {
        /* Here we write() to the socket the main thread has open
@@ -586,8 +608,16 @@ void NotifyMainThread(SQLConnection* connection_with_new_result)
         * thread, we can just use standard connect(), and we can
         * block if we like. We just send the connection id of the
         * connection back.
+        *
+        * NOTE: We only send a single char down the connection, this
+        * way we know it wont get a partial read at the other end if
+        * the system is especially congested (see bug #263).
+        * The function FindCharId translates a connection name into a
+        * one character id, and GetCharId translates a character id
+        * back into an iterator.
         */
-       send(QueueFD, connection_with_new_result->GetID().c_str(), connection_with_new_result->GetID().length()+1, 0);
+       char id = FindCharId(connection_with_new_result->GetID());
+       send(QueueFD, &id, 1, 0);
 }
